When farmer Rubens Braz began breeding Brazilian chickens, he had no concept how massive the operation – or the birds – would get, in response to Reuters.

Some 20 years later, he now raises large roosters for small-scale farming and passion functions in central Brazil and is making a dwelling from surging gross sales throughout the nation.

His birds, known as “Large Indian Roosters,” can develop over 120 centimeters (47 inches) tall.

The gargantuan fowl, that are awaiting formal recognition as a brand new breed, can fetch as a lot as 20,000 reais ($4,000) every, Braz stated, from among the 1000’s of breeders within the nation.

“It was a passion at first,” he stated in an interview at considered one of his nurseries within the state of Goias. “Then different breeders bought and at present we’ve got a business operation.”

His agency, known as Avicultura Gigante, remains to be a distinct segment participant in Brazil, the world’s largest poultry exporter and residential to main meatpackers together with BRF and JBS.

As the worldwide avian influenza disaster has put a damper on enterprise this 12 months, limiting the transport of reside animals in Brazil, Braz stated he has targeted on supplying fertilised eggs to close by farmers. His personal farms home some 300 birds.

Whereas that isn’t sufficient to serve the meat trade, he stated there’s loads of demand from collectors and farmers seeking to bolster their flocks of “caipira” chickens, or cage-free animals raised on small properties primarily for subsistence functions.
